Brown the Ground Beef
The heart of any good bowl is the protein, and for our beefy garlic butter bowl, nothing beats browning some ground beef to perfection. Start by heating a large skillet over medium-high heat, then add 1 pound of ground beef.
-
Sizzle and Spice: As the beef starts to brown, use a wooden spoon to break it apart. This ensures even cooking and browning, which adds a lovely flavor. Season with salt, pepper, and your choice of spices. Consider adding garlic powder for an extra kick that complements the dish beautifully.
-
Watch the Drippings: Keep an eye on the beef as it cooks, stirring occasionally for about 6-8 minutes until it’s well-browned. Once ready, drain any excess fat and set it aside.
This step sets a solid base for the beefy garlic butter bowl, infusing it with rich, meaty goodness.
Make the Creamy Garlic Butter Rice
Next up, let’s whip up some creamy garlic butter rice. This rich, flavorful base will really elevate your dish.
-
In a medium saucepan, melt 2 tablespoons of butter over medium heat. Add 2 cups of rinsed jasmine or basmati rice to the pan. Stir for about a minute until the rice is well-coated and slightly toasted.
-
Flavor Infusion: Pour in 4 cups of chicken broth instead of plain water for added depth of flavor. Toss in 4 minced garlic cloves and a pinch of salt. Bring the mixture to a boil, then reduce the heat to low, cover, and simmer for approximately 15-20 minutes until the rice is fluffy and the broth is absorbed.
The aroma from this step will make your kitchen feel like a gourmet restaurant!

Best Practices for Creamy Rice
Achieving the perfect creamy rice base for your beefy garlic butter bowl involves a few simple tricks. Start by rinsing your rice under cold water to remove excess starch, which prevents it from becoming gummy. An ideal ratio is usually 1 cup of rice to 2 cups of broth or water. Consider using a flavorful broth instead of plain water to infuse rich taste into your rice. Allow your rice to simmer gently and keep the lid on while cooking; this locks in the steam for a fluffier texture.

PrintBeefy Garlic Butter Bowl: An Indulgent Twist on Comfort Food
Indulge in this rich and savory Beefy Garlic Butter Bowl that transforms traditional comfort food into a gourmet experience.
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 15 minutes
- Total Time: 25 minutes
- Yield: 4 servings 1x
- Category: Main Course
- Method: Skillet
- Cuisine: American
- Diet: High Protein
Ingredients
- 1 pound ground beef
- 4 tablespoons garlic butter
- 2 cups cooked rice
- 1 cup broccoli florets
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 teaspoon pepper
- 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
Instructions
- In a skillet, cook the ground beef over medium heat until browned.
- Add garlic butter and stir until melted and well combined.
- Incorporate the cooked rice and broccoli, mixing well.
- Season with salt and pepper to taste.
- Remove from heat and sprinkle with Parmesan cheese before serving.
Notes
- For extra flavor, add sautéed onions and bell peppers.
- Customize with your choice of vegetables.
